Objectives and Governance

The business of the Club is managed by a Committee of Management
consisting of Office Bearers and up to six committee members.

During the 50 years plus that the club has operated its strong sense of community participation has remained. Today the diversity of its membership and the opportunities for its members to participate in both internal club events and through Coast Archers, external archery tournaments has widened the scope of the club’s activities. The Articles of Association of the Club reflect this wider scope.

Recognising that not all members of the club want to or indeed are able to participate in external tournaments, due to age, disability or economic circumstance, the Articles of Association have been established to provide a framework within which the club will function and meet the objectives set out in the Memorandum whilst not discriminating between members who wish to participate in the internal activities of the club only and those who seek a wider participation in the sport of archery, as such these articles provide a framework for the participation of all members.

Club Objectives

  • Support and promote all forms of Archery and the spirit of good fellowship.

  • Raise public awareness of Archery as a recreational and competitive sport.

  • Develop archer resources and services and facilitate and encourage participation and membership.

  • Conduct archery tournaments and social events for club members and visitors from other archery clubs.

  • Promote member participation at Regional, State and National Tournaments.

  • Recognise and maintain club records and make claims for and on behalf of Members.

  • Raise the quality of performance in Archery through the provision of technical support and coaching.

  • Endorse the doping policies of FITA and Archery Australia.
